What are some effective techniques for securing API endpoints against unauthorized access?

Securing API endpoints against unauthorized access is crucial to protect sensitive data and maintain system integrity. Implementing robust authentication and authorization mechanisms, along with encryption and monitoring, can significantly enhance API security.
Example Concept: To secure API endpoints, use OAuth 2.0 for robust authentication and authorization, ensuring that only authenticated users can access the API. Implement rate limiting to prevent abuse and DDoS attacks, and use HTTPS to encrypt data in transit. Additionally, employ API gateways to manage and monitor traffic, and regularly audit API access logs to detect and respond to unauthorized access attempts.

- Implement strong authentication methods like API keys or JWTs (JSON Web Tokens).
- Use role-based access control (RBAC) to limit access based on user roles.
- Regularly update and patch API components to address vulnerabilities.
- Conduct security testing, such as penetration testing, to identify potential weaknesses.
- Ensure proper input validation to prevent injection attacks.
